Named by Radusinović and Markov (1971) after what was, at the time, the constituent country of Macedonia, Yugoslavia. The area is now the country of North Macedonia. The area includes the type locality of Crni Kamen.
Type Locality:
A rare accessory mineral in microcline-quartz syenite pegmatite veins and as inclusions in oxide phases in a metamorphosed Fe-Mn ore body.

Macedonite is an oxide single perovskite with second order Jahn-Teller distortions. The Macedonite fromCrni Kamen is the only natural perovskite mineral known to contain significant amounts of Bi2O3 (2.2 wt.%) (Mitchellet al. 2016).

General Appearance of Type Material:
Small (< 0.2mm) crystals.
Place of Conservation of Type Material:
Institute for Nuclear Raw Materials, Belgrade, Serbia.
U.S. National Museum of Natural History, Washington, D.C., USA: #122391.
Geological Setting of Type Material:
Microcline-quartz syenite pegmatite veins cutting pyroxene amphibole schist.
